Meat Lovers Pizza Casserole: A Hearty Fusion Bake

The Meat Lovers Pizza Casserole is what happens when two comfort-food classics collide: the bold, savory toppings of a meat-loaded pizza and the warm, layered structure of a baked casserole. It’s rich, cheesy, and deeply satisfying—perfect for family dinners, potlucks, or meal prep when you want something filling and crowd-pleasing.

Unlike traditional pizza, this dish skips the doughy crust and instead builds layers of pasta, sauce, cheese, and multiple meats baked together into a bubbling, golden-topped casserole.

Ingredients You’ll Need

For a standard 9×13-inch casserole:

Meats

  • ½ lb ground beef
  • ½ lb Italian sausage (mild or spicy)
  • ½ cup pepperoni slices
  • ½ cup cooked bacon pieces

Base

  • 12 oz pasta (penne, rotini, or rigatoni work best)

Sauce & Flavor

  • 2 to 2½ cups pizza sauce or marinara
  • 2 cloves garlic (minced)
  • 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
  • ½ teaspoon crushed red pepper (optional)

Cheese

  • 2 cups shredded mozzarella
  • ½ cup grated parmesan
  • Optional: provolone slices for layering

Extras (optional but recommended)

  • Sliced black olives
  • Diced onions
  • Bell peppers

Step-by-Step Cooking Method

Step 1: Cook the pasta

Boil pasta in salted water until just al dente.
Do not overcook—it will continue baking later in the oven. Drain and set aside.


Step 2: Brown the meats

In a large skillet over medium heat:

  • Cook ground beef until browned.
  • Add Italian sausage and break it apart as it cooks.
  • Drain excess fat to avoid a greasy casserole.

Once cooked, stir in garlic and let it sauté for 30–60 seconds to release aroma.
